Then that should tell you right there that you should make a demo that shows that you're good at plotscripting and stories but not so hot at everything else. The fact that you might be bad at oh, say, graphics (I'm going to use that example throughout this post) doesn't inhibit your ability to create a demo that shows off your skills in the areas that you are proficient in. Once you've shown us via a demo that your plotscripting and story abilities are "good" (your words, not mine), then perhaps someone might see "Hey, that guy's pretty good at story and plotscripting, but not good at graphics, and I'm good at graphics and not that good with story, so maybe I'll join his group". That's the best way to find someone who would be willing to work with you, and that is the advice I give you as a fellow designer who is good at stories and plotscripting (and gameplay) but very, very bad at graphics.  _________________
